I need update many cPanel servers with CloudLinux 7.x to 8.x using cPanel Elevate process. A few weeks ago I check the servers using command "/scripts/elevate-cpanel --check" and all are OK to elevate. The last weekend I tried run the command but cPanel Elevate show many issues with CloudLinux packages:
All packages are related to MySQL database versions not supported in CloudLinux 8. After I removed this packages, the command show again that is OK to elevate this server to CloudLinux 8.
This only occurred on servers that had an automatic Cloudlinux update where PHP 8.5 was installed.
I opened a ticket with cPanel support, who informed me that there is a recent issue that is being investigated to identify what is causing this alert.
In parallel, EasyApache 4 stopped working correctly, displaying the error in /usr/local/cpanel/logs/error_log below when run (for any action):
[2026-02-07 22:45:23 -0300] info [xml-api] The package “alt-libcurlssl11” conflicts and we need to install it resolve deps [package_manager_resolve_actions] version [1].
Has anyone else encountered this problem? After removing the conflicting packages, is it safe to run cPanel Elevate?

It appears the conflicting alt‑php packages you’re seeing during the ELevate process are tied to an internal issue currently being investigated by our developers under case RE‑1650. At this time, the best course of action is to hold off on the ELevate conversion until this case has been resolved. Once a fix is released, it will be reflected in our official changelogs. You can find the cPanel & WHM changelogs here:
Where can I locate the cPanel changelogs?
Regarding the EasyApache 4 issue, this is associated with a separate active case: CPANEL‑51189. Currently, the only known workaround applies specifically to CloudLinux 8 environments. Since your system is running CloudLinux 7, we’ve added your report to the case so our development team is aware that CL7 servers are affected as well.
You may follow the article below to be notified as soon as a fix becomes available:Unable to install packages via EasyApache 4 on CloudLinux 8
